The steam remaining from … A water tower is an elevated structure supporting a water tank constructed at a height sufficient to pressurize a distribution system for potable water, and to provide emergency storage for fire protection. Water towers often operate in conjunction with underground or surface service reservoirs, which store treated water close to where it will be used. Other types of water towers may only stor…

WebAn energy tower (also known as a downdraft energy tower, because the air flows down the tower) is a tall (1,000 meters) and wide (400 meters) hollow cylinder with a water spray system at the top. Pumps lift the water to the top of the tower and then spray the water inside the tower. Evaporation of water cools the hot, dry air hovering at the ... WebDec 17, 2024 · In a sense, the towers store both water and energy. The pressure of the water when it reaches a house is very important. Increased water pressure can lead to unneeded costs in transporting water and damage to the pipes carrying the water. Lower water pressure inconveniences the end user and can cause contaminants to collect in the water. Water towers are used to store and deliver pressurized water to a community: First, water is sourced (usually from a reservoir, river, … WebMay 22, 2024 · The flowrate through the cooling system (with wet cooling towers) may be up to 100 000 m3/h(27.7 m3/s). The condenser inlet water may have about22°C(strongly depending on ambient conditions), while the condenser outlet may have about 25°C. The sea water cooling systems operate at higher flowrates, for example, 130 000 m3/h.
